To find the radius of a circle given its circumference, you can use the formula C = 2πr, where C is the circumference and r is the radius.

In this case, the circumference is given as 32 centimeters. So, we have the equation 32 = 2πr.

First, divide both sides of the equation by 2π to isolate the variable r:
r = 32 / (2π).

Now, calculate the value of r using a calculator or an estimate for π. Let's use the approximation π ≈ 3.14:
r ≈ 32 / (2 * 3.14) ≈ 5.095.

Looking at the answer choices, the value closest to 5.095 centimeters is 5.1 centimeters, which is option B.
